About JOLLY HOLIDAYS MARSHMALLOW POLES
JOLLY HOLIDAYS MARSHMALLOW POLES is a calorie-dense food with 381 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is carbohydrates, providing 2.4g of protein, 90.5g of carbohydrates, and 0g of fat. This food belongs to the Candy category.
Ingredients
SUGAR, GLUCOSE SYRUP, GELATIN, WATER, CORN STARCH, SORBITOL, ARTIFICIAL FLAVORS, ARTIFICIAL COLORS (FD&C RED #40, FD&C YELLOW #5, FD&C BLUE #1)
